Leaders of the so-called G5 West African Sahel nations are meeting in Chad to discuss the region's security situation. French President Emmanuel Macron and German Foreign Minister Heiko Maass will also participate via videolink. Sahel countries are vulnerable to terrorist attacks and there are widespread allegations of corruption and negligence against governments. The so-called G5 countries of the Sahel include Chad as well as Mauritania, Mali, Niger, and Burkina Faso. Germany and the EU have invested billions in development and military aid. But much of the region remains unstable.
That's led to a sense of frustration at the ongoing mission - due to its high costs and low returns.
